Your Body Type - Ectomorph, Mesomorph or Endomorph?
Your body type can influence how you respond to different types of workouts and diet plans. This guide helps you understand your body type (ectomorph, mesomorph or endomorph) and how you can structure your workout and diet for success.

When I first got into the muscle building scene I was overwhelmed by the amount of different training programs, bodybuilding supplements, diets, articles and information there was out there. There were so many conflicting diets and training programs available and I had no idea what I “should” be doing. The result of this was about 6 months in the gym with little gains and almost no motivation to workout anymore. I was at a complete loss and about to throw in the towel and give up. Then a guy in the gym gave me a magazine and told me to read the article in there about body types. So I did and it opened my eyes up to the reason why I wasn’t making any gains in the gym. I am a true ectomorph (classic hardgainer) and my bodyweight was 60.2kg (132.5lbs) when I first walked into a gym. I had no idea about body types back then. I assumed (like most beginners do) that the more I worked out the bigger I would get. Thinking that “more was better” I started following a program designed for an elite bodybuilder. This resulted in gains of about 1.7kg in 6 months. After reading the body type article in that magazine I started to understand more about how my body type worked, my metabolism, and gaining weight. Being an ectomorph I need to focus on calorie intake, long rest periods, and minimum cardio. It was only then I started making some real gains and I’ve never looked back. So it’s important to be able to identify and understand your body type. Different body types require different training methods and diet plans.
